Re: tile cache layer in Mapwick — don't ship this without bounding the LRU. Unbounded entries killed the renderer last quarter. Eviction should key on zoom level, not raw tile count, or low-zoom tiles starve everything else. If you get paged, check these first. The constants we settled on are below.

tuning constants:
QUOTAS = {
    "druwyn": 5,
    "holix": 5,
    "zorath": 5,
    "holwyn": 10,
}

**Q: What happens when Mailcull marks a bounce as permanent?**

Mailcull, our email bounce processor, classifies hard bounces after three consecutive failures and suppresses the address automatically. Soft bounces are retried for 72 hours. If the suppression list itself becomes corrupted, restore it from the encrypted nightly snapshot in the Thornfield backup bucket. Restoring requires the team recovery passphrase, which is kept directly below this entry for emergencies.

unlock words, kahof-bahap: praax-ulaix

Break-Glass Access — Nimbus Admin Dashboard (Dark Mode)

Dark-mode theme config for the Nimbus admin dashboard lives behind the appearance-admin account. If it locks during a theming incident, users may get unreadable contrast in dark mode. Break-glass applies: skip normal approval, use the emergency recovery flow on the bastion, and log the action afterward. The break-glass recovery passphrase follows below.

vault phrase of tawig-taduf = zorath-oliwyn

Attendees reviewed progress on qualifying a backup supplier for the alloy castings currently sourced solely from Drayfield Metalworks. Two candidates, Ostram Foundries and Quill & Harber, passed initial audits; sample runs begin next month. Branch managers were asked to flag any quality variances promptly during trials and to keep customer commitments unchanged until qualification completes. Costs remain within the approved envelope. The strategic context for this effort is recorded confidentially below.

board note of kageg-bahof: The renewal with Holwynax Holdings closes at $2 million a year, 5 percent below the last contract. Project Ulaath slips by two quarters because of the supplier delay.